When installing the cable in gutters and drainage pipes, use the “double run”
of the cable. Clips should be attached every 12-inches. Spacers should be in-
stalled every 3-feet along the roof. The cable should be suspended at the bot-
tom of the gutter.
Figure 20. Cable double run inside the gutter.
